Park Board approves vending, sponsorships, tree-planting policy, vendor contracts, Wilson Park design work, and beer garden revenue policy

At the February 19, 2026 Board of Park Commissioners meeting the board unanimously approved meeting minutes, accepted donations and sponsorships, authorized a park vending permit, revised the Arboriculture Specifications Manual to give Forestry staff authority to specify appropriate tree types, approved beer garden-related vendor agreements and a fundraiser, authorized Graef Consulting for Wilson Park design/oversight, and adopted a Beer Garden Revenue Policy.

Key decisions

- Approved minutes of the January 15, 2026 Board of Park Commissioners meeting (unanimous).
- Accepted a $1,500 donation from Durr CTS Inc. for individual sponsorship of Beer Gardens on June 16 and August 4, 2026 (unanimous).
- Approved a Park Vending Permit with Swamp Donkey for a bait vending machine at Voyageur Park (unanimous).
- Approved staff-recommended revisions to the Arboriculture Specifications Manual to allow the Forestry Department to request appropriate tree types for planting locations (unanimous).
- Approved a pop-up beer garden fundraiser with Stubborn Brothers to benefit the dog park (unanimous).
- Approved a 3-year agreement with Kay Distributing as the beer vendor for the Beer Gardens (unanimous).
- Approved a proposal from Graef Consulting for $19,500 to provide design and construction oversight for the Wilson Park renovation project (unanimous).
- Approved the Beer Garden Revenue Policy directing review of beer garden revenues alongside the CIP and submission of funding recommendations to the City Manager and Finance Director (unanimous).
- Noted staff updates on $750 donations each from IEI General Contractors, Inc. and Immel Construction Inc. as individual Beer Garden sponsors (informational).
